How to configure and maintain Active Directory step by step?

On the next "Database and Log Folders" page, you can change the location of active directory database folder and Log folder also. For best performance, store these folders on separate partition or hard disks. Click Next for default setting.

 

Now wizard will show you the path of "Shared system Volume folder location", you should not change its default path. Click Next for default setting.

On next page, select, "Install and Configure the DNS Server" and set computer to use this DNS as its preferred DNS server and click Next button.

On permission page, select the option "Permissions compatible only with 2000 or Window sever 2003 operating systems" and again click Next.

On the page "Directory Services Restore Mode Administrator Password" and give "Restore Mode Password", if you want otherwise leave this empty and click Next.

  

Click Next on Summary page, after this active directory service will be start to install.

After complete the wizard, Restart your computer to save settings.
